Health & Social Care Tutor

The Role

We are looking for an inspiring Health & Social Care Tutor to join our GAPS Centre in Basildon (Southgate), supporting learners aged 16–18 and 19–24 with EHCPs.

You will deliver engaging Health & Social Care lessons at Entry Level 3 and Level 1, adapting your teaching to meet individual needs.

You will support learners to develop their skills, build confidence and prepare for further education, employment and adulthood.

This role would suit an enthusiastic, resilient and motivated educator who can build positive relationships with young people, including those with complex learning needs.

Key Responsibilities

  • Plan and deliver engaging Health & Social Care lessons at Entry Level 3 and Level 1.
  • Develop schemes of work, lesson plans and resources appropriate to learner needs.
  • Differentiate teaching in line with EHCPs and individual learning requirements.
  • Assess learner work, maintain portfolios and track progress against qualification requirements.
  • Set and review SMART targets and conduct regular learner progress reviews.
  • Provide guidance, encouragement and additional support where required.
  • Work effectively with Learning Support Assistants to ensure learners are appropriately supported.
  • Manage classroom behaviour in line with organisational policies.
  • Provide enrichment opportunities and use technology to enhance learning.
  • Maintain accurate assessment, progress and learner records.
  • Work collaboratively with colleagues, parents, external agencies and the Quality Assurance Team.
  • Attend standardisation meetings and maintain relevant CPD.
  • Follow safeguarding, Prevent, health and safety and other organisational procedures.
  • Contribute to continuous improvement and participate in inspections and relevant events.
  • Demonstrate flexibility and willingness to travel to other locations when required.

Skills and Experience

  • Health & Social Care qualification at Level 3 or above.
  • Recognised teaching qualification such as PTLLS, CTLLS, DTLLS, Cert Ed, PGCE or equivalent.
  • Appropriate Assessor qualification and experience.
  • GCSE English and Maths Grade C/4 or above, or equivalent Level 2 Functional Skills.
  • Experience teaching Health & Social Care and/or working with young people aged 16–24.
  • Experience supporting learners with SEND, complex needs and/or EHCPs.
  • Strong understanding of differentiation and learner-centred teaching.
  • Excellent communication, organisation and classroom management skills.
  • Ability to build positive relationships with young people and respond confidently to challenging situations.
  • Experience assessing learner work and monitoring progress.
  • Patient, enthusiastic, resilient and adaptable approach.
  • Commitment to safeguarding, equality, inclusion and continuous professional development.
